- [ ] **Step 7: Breaker override escrow.** After sealing the signing keys for the Tallgrove upstream API circuit breaker, confirm the support team can force the breaker open during a full outage. The override bundle lives in the sealed escrow drawer and is useless without its unlock phrase. Two ceremony witnesses must initial this step before proceeding. The escrow bundle is decrypted with the recovery passphrase that follows.

vault phrase of kahip-kahop = holath-quenmir

Welcome to the Pingloft webhook team! Quick note on retries: failed deliveries back off exponentially (5s, 25s, 2m, up to 6 attempts), and every retry re-signs the payload with our HMAC key so receivers can verify nothing got tampered with mid-flight. For local testing, your env file needs the signing secret on the next line.

vault entry, yahif-yajep: COURIER_KEY29=b802bdf8034096b65a51c6ba5abe2

Future maintainers should know that factories are versioned alongside schema migrations; if a migration lands without a matching factory update, the nightly suite fails fast with a schema-drift error. To regenerate fixtures, run the seed command with the frozen clock flag, then commit the snapshot directory in the same change. Never hand-edit snapshots. When filing a regression, always attach the factory build that produced the bad fixtures, noted below.

session token of yahof-bajeg = htk9_0d43d44ed

## Who to ping about GiftNote

Welcome aboard! GiftNote is our donation-receipt mailer for the Larchfield Fund. Template tweaks go to the comms folks; delivery failures and bounce weirdness go to the platform crew. Don't push template changes on Fridays — receipts batch over the weekend. For anything GiftNote-related, start with the address below.

billing contact of kaweg-tajeg = drudor.lamion.oliath@torvalabs.test

This note covers Ledgerpane, our audit-log viewer, for this week's sync. Ledgerpane reads the append-only event store and renders filtered timelines; it never mutates records, by design. Access tiers are reviewer, auditor, and admin — please verify your tier before demoing. The export feature is gated behind the sealed credentials bundle, and opening that bundle during the session requires the recovery passphrase below.

unlock words, yawig-kagef: gordor-holvan-ulaael-pramir-ulaiel-tamdor